Transaction 3a95df782bf98275ddc3ee7dd4339f3dd99fa774898469964066aed6065971d2

1 Input
2 Outputs
  • 3a95df782bf98275ddc3ee7dd4339f3dd99fa774898469964066aed6065971d2:0
  • value  13759322
    address  1FiyBBKtT16pCMQ8AyioAUM2fmXbdXzJX9
  • 3a95df782bf98275ddc3ee7dd4339f3dd99fa774898469964066aed6065971d2:1
  • value  13828526875
    address  3MxdrDNx86F3PZbNk74HxuEUzCaHgbPwGd